Output 5e8b77c730902658c819344b435151fd7fc88956e76036d0239f3fec9d4e1a8f:13

value
510912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5498a46b69333ecf58742764d5b6cf4d3efc820b OP_EQUAL
address
39QKYRmr2MkzgW7GSZZEMwXjnZLEvGiwBo
transaction
5e8b77c730902658c819344b435151fd7fc88956e76036d0239f3fec9d4e1a8f
spent
true